Computer >> कंप्यूटर >  >> प्रणाली >> Windows

आपका प्रश्न:मैं Linux में स्क्रिप्ट की अनुमति कैसे दूं?

मैं शेल स्क्रिप्ट को अनुमति कैसे दे सकता हूं?

लिनक्स में निर्देशिका अनुमतियां बदलने के लिए, निम्न का उपयोग करें:

  1. chmod +rwx फ़ाइल नाम अनुमति जोड़ने के लिए।
  2. chmod -rwx निर्देशिका नाम अनुमतियाँ हटाने के लिए।
  3. निष्पादन योग्य अनुमतियों की अनुमति देने के लिए
  4. chmod +x फ़ाइल नाम।
  5. chmod -wx फ़ाइल नाम लिखने और निष्पादन योग्य अनुमतियाँ निकालने के लिए।

मैं बैश स्क्रिप्ट की अनुमति कैसे दूं?

आपके पास दो विकल्प हैं:

  1. इसे बैश करने के लिए एक तर्क के रूप में चलाएँ:बैश /var/www/script.
  2. वैकल्पिक रूप से, निष्पादन बिट सेट करें:chmod +x /var/www/script. और, अब आप इसे सीधे निष्पादित कर सकते हैं:/var/www/script.

स्क्रिप्ट चलाने के लिए आपको किन अनुमतियों की आवश्यकता होगी?

आप नहीं फ़ाइल को निष्पादित करने के लिए पढ़ने की अनुमति की आवश्यकता है। वास्तव में, यदि आपके पास पढ़ने की अनुमति है, लेकिन अनुमति निष्पादित नहीं है, तो आप फ़ाइल को निष्पादित नहीं कर सकते। निष्पादन अनुमति आपको सिस्टम को स्क्रिप्ट फ़ाइल निष्पादित करने के लिए कहने की अनुमति देती है। किसी स्क्रिप्ट को निष्पादित करने के लिए (उदाहरण के लिए script.sh)।

chmod 777 का क्या अर्थ है?

किसी फ़ाइल या निर्देशिका में 777 अनुमतियाँ सेट करने का अर्थ है कि यह सभी उपयोगकर्ताओं द्वारा पठनीय, लिखने योग्य और निष्पादन योग्य होगी और एक बड़ा सुरक्षा जोखिम पैदा कर सकती है . ... chmod कमांड के साथ chown कमांड और अनुमतियों का उपयोग करके फ़ाइल के स्वामित्व को बदला जा सकता है।

क्यों शेल स्क्रिप्ट अनुमति अस्वीकृत है?

बैश अनुमति अस्वीकृत त्रुटि इंगित करती है कि आप उस फ़ाइल को निष्पादित करने का प्रयास कर रहे हैं जिसे चलाने की आपको अनुमति नहीं है . इस समस्या को ठीक करने के लिए, स्वयं को अनुमति देने के लिए chmod u+x कमांड का उपयोग करें। यदि आप इस आदेश का उपयोग नहीं कर सकते हैं, तो आपको फ़ाइल तक पहुंच प्राप्त करने के लिए अपने सिस्टम व्यवस्थापक से संपर्क करने की आवश्यकता हो सकती है।

मैं यूनिक्स में अनुमति को कैसे ठीक करूं?

Linux में अनुमति अस्वीकृत त्रुटि को ठीक करने के लिए, किसी को स्क्रिप्ट की फ़ाइल अनुमति को बदलने की आवश्यकता है . इस उद्देश्य के लिए "chmod" (चेंज मोड) कमांड का उपयोग करें।

मैं Linux में अनुमतियों की जांच कैसे करूं?

लिनक्स में चेक अनुमतियां कैसे देखें

  1. उस फ़ाइल का पता लगाएँ जिसकी आप जाँच करना चाहते हैं, आइकन पर राइट-क्लिक करें, और गुण चुनें।
  2. इससे शुरू में एक नई विंडो खुलती है जिसमें फ़ाइल के बारे में बुनियादी जानकारी दिखाई देती है। ...
  3. वहां, आप देखेंगे कि प्रत्येक फ़ाइल की अनुमति तीन श्रेणियों के अनुसार भिन्न होती है:

क्या करता है — R — मतलब Linux?

फ़ाइल मोड। r अक्षर का अर्थ है उपयोगकर्ता के पास फ़ाइल/निर्देशिका पढ़ने की अनुमति है . ... और x अक्षर का अर्थ है कि उपयोगकर्ता के पास फ़ाइल/निर्देशिका को निष्पादित करने की अनुमति है।

Linux में T बिट क्या है?

एक चिपचिपा बिट एक अनुमति बिट है जो एक निर्देशिका पर सेट है जो केवल उस निर्देशिका के भीतर फ़ाइल के स्वामी को अनुमति देता है , फ़ाइल को हटाने या नाम बदलने के लिए निर्देशिका या रूट उपयोगकर्ता का स्वामी। किसी अन्य उपयोगकर्ता के पास किसी अन्य उपयोगकर्ता द्वारा बनाई गई फ़ाइल को हटाने के लिए आवश्यक विशेषाधिकार नहीं हैं।

निर्देशिका में आने के लिए न्यूनतम न्यूनतम अनुमतियों की क्या आवश्यकता है?

किसी खाते के लिए लिखने की अनुमति की आवश्यकता होती है एक निर्देशिका के लिए निर्देशिका सामग्री में परिवर्तन करने में सक्षम होने के लिए, जैसे कि वहां नई फाइलें बनाना। बाइनरी 10 दशमलव 2 है, और "लिखने" की अनुमति अक्सर संक्षिप्त रूप से w होती है। 1 बाइनरी नंबर 1 अनुदान निष्पादित करने की अनुमति देता है।

मैं निष्पादन के बिना शेल स्क्रिप्ट कैसे चलाऊं?

निष्पादन अनुमतियों के बिना शेल स्क्रिप्ट के लिए, आपको स्क्रिप्ट को अपनी पसंद के दुभाषिया के तर्क के रूप में पारित करने की आवश्यकता होगी . यहां आपके शेल दुभाषिया के लिए निष्पादन अनुमतियों की जांच की जाती है, न कि स्क्रिप्ट के लिए। तो आपको /bin/sh के लिए निष्पादित करना चाहिए था और आपकी स्क्रिप्ट में केवल पढ़ने की अनुमति हो सकती है।


  1. Windows

    USB Immunizer से अपने कंप्यूटर को ऑटोरन संक्रमणों से सुरक्षित रखें

    USB फ्लैश ड्राइव, निस्संदेह, अद्भुत उपकरण हैं जो हमारी पोर्टेबिलिटी में सुधार करते हैं और हमें आसानी से एक कंप्यूटर से दूसरे कंप्यूटर में फ़ाइलों को स्थानांतरित करने की अनुमति देते हैं। लगातार बढ़ती लोकप्रियता के साथ, वे सभी द्वारा उपयोग किए जाते हैं और हैकर्स और अन्य साइबर अपराधियों के लिए वायरस और

  1. Windows 10

    अपने कंप्यूटर पर ब्लू-रे डिस्क कैसे चलाएं

    उन दिनों को याद करें जब आप अपने पीसी में डिस्क डालते थे और मूवी देखते थे? यह अब इतना आसान नहीं है। नए डिवाइस अब डिफ़ॉल्ट ऑप्टिकल डिवाइस के साथ नहीं आते हैं, विंडोज़ ने मीडिया सेंटर को बंद कर दिया है, और लोग अब डिस्क का उपयोग नहीं करते हैं। जैसे-जैसे अधिक लोग अपने पीसी का उपयोग घरेलू मनोरंजन के लिए

  1. Linux

    USB फ्लैश ड्राइव का उपयोग करके अपने कंप्यूटर पर Ubuntu स्थापित करें

    उबंटू आज उपलब्ध सबसे लोकप्रिय लिनक्स ऑपरेटिंग सिस्टम है। यह दुनिया भर के व्यवसायों पर निर्भर है और अधिकांश लोगों का पहला Linux अनुभव है। चाहे आप विंडोज से उबंटू में स्विच करना चाहते हों, नया कंप्यूटर सेट करना चाहते हों या वर्चुअल मशीन बनाना चाहते हों, आपको पहले उबंटू को इंस्टॉल करना होगा। आरंभ करन